The NYC dance-punk lifers have been chronicling the perpetual meltdown that is American society for nearly 20 years now, from the clattering full-band thrust of their instantly iconic single "Me and Giuliani Down by the Schoolyard A True Story " to the dark disco of 's wonderfully eclectic Shake the Shudder. Their eighth full-length, Wallop, follows in the band's grand tradition of plugging straight into our collective nervous system and sending funky, rubbery shock waves through the body politic. If you've found yourself rubbing your temples while contemplating the collapse of everything around us? Like an apocalyptic jukebox, Wallop is jam-packed with various sounds and styles from dance music's rich history—from the pie-eyed psychedelia of Madchester-era English dance-rock to tunnel-vision techno and the flashy, bomb-dropping sound of UK grime.

A woman who has become known as the Chk-Chk Boom girl after her witness account of a shooting in Sydney has inspired a dance re-mix on YouTube. Clare Werbeloff, 19, has become so popular in the wake of her politically incorrect television interview that she has reportedly hired a PR firm to deal with her publicity. Ms Werbeloff was in Kings Cross about 3am on Sunday morning when a man was shot in the leg.
